DIY vs Professional Flood Damage Restoration: What You Need to Know
After water damage, it's tempting to handle cleanup yourself. Here's an honest comparison:
DIY-Friendly
- ✓Shop vac can remove surface water (but not moisture inside walls)
- ✓Household fans circulate air (but don't control humidity levels)
- ✓Bleach kills surface mold (but doesn't address root causes or hidden growth)
- ✓Cost: $50-200 in supplies (but risk of $5,000-20,000+ in mold remediation later)
Call a Professional
- ★Commercial extractors remove water 10-50x faster than shop vacs
- ★Industrial dehumidifiers + air movers dry structures in 3-5 days (preventing mold)
- ★Thermal imaging finds hidden moisture you can't see or feel
- ★Professional documentation gets insurance claims approved (average 94% approval rate)
For minor surface spills, DIY is fine. For anything involving saturated drywall, carpet padding, or water that sat for more than a few hours — professional Flood Damage Restoration prevents damage that costs 5-10x more to fix later.

How long does water damage restoration take in Chamblee?
Timeline depends on damage severity. Water extraction takes 2-6 hours, structural drying takes 3-5 days (monitored with daily moisture readings), and rebuilding varies from 1 day for minor repairs to 2-4 weeks for major reconstruction. The key factor is response time — every hour of delay increases total restoration time and cost. PrimeWave Water Damage Repair begins extraction within 60 minutes of your call in Chamblee.
Will my insurance cover water damage restoration in Chamblee?
Most GA homeowner policies cover sudden, accidental water damage (burst pipes, appliance failures, storm damage). Gradual damage from deferred maintenance is typically excluded. PrimeWave Water Damage Repair handles insurance documentation for every job — timestamped photos, certified moisture readings, equipment logs, and line-item cost breakdowns. Our documentation results in a 97% claim approval rate for Chamblee clients.
How do you prevent mold after water damage in Chamblee?
Mold begins germinating within 24-48 hours of water exposure at relative humidity above 60%. Our protocol includes immediate water extraction, antimicrobial surface treatment, commercial dehumidification to bring humidity below 50%, and daily moisture monitoring of affected materials (target: below 15% for wood, below 1% for concrete). We don't leave until readings confirm the structure is safe.

Building Codes & Safety Requirements for Flood Damage Restoration in Chamblee
Important regulatory information for property owners
IICRC S500 Standards
All water damage restoration performed by PrimeWave Water Damage Repair follows IICRC S500 standards — the industry reference for professional water damage restoration. This includes proper classification of water damage (Category 1-3) and class designation (Class 1-4) for your Chamblee property.
GA Environmental Regulations
Contaminated water (Category 2 and 3) requires specific handling and disposal procedures under GA environmental law. Our crews follow proper containment and disposal protocols for all contaminated materials removed from Chamblee properties.
Electrical Safety During Restoration
Water-damaged properties require electrical clearance before power can be restored. We coordinate with licensed electricians and the local utility to ensure safe power restoration per GA electrical code.
Occupancy Requirements
Depending on damage severity, Chamblee building officials may require a habitability inspection before residents can return. We work with local inspectors to expedite this process and get you back home safely.
Asbestos & Hazmat Protocols
Older properties in Chamblee may contain asbestos in flooring, insulation, or joint compound. When suspected, we arrange proper testing before disturbing materials and follow EPA NESHAP requirements for abatement if needed.

What should I do while waiting for your crew to arrive?
- If it's safe: turn off electricity to the affected area, stop the water source if you can identify it, move valuables to dry areas, and avoid walking through standing water (it may be contaminated). Don't try to use a household vacuum on water — it's a shock risk. We'll handle everything else when we arrive.
